    The Amazon Echo Spot stands out for combining a smart alarm clock with a vibrant touch screen, making it a versatile addition to any dad’s bedroom or living space. Its rich sound quality and smart home integration mean it can control compatible devices via voice, which is especially handy for hands-free routines. Compared to the Echo Show 5, its smaller display limits multimedia, but the compact size and privacy controls make it suitable for bedrooms or small spaces. The dual Wi-Fi bands and eero Built-in improve network coverage, though it doesn’t have a camera, limiting video features. It’s perfect for dads who want a smart device that blends functionality with privacy and unobtrusiveness.

    The Amazon Smart Plug offers a straightforward way to automate household devices with just a voice command or app. Its compact design allows it to fit into most outlets without blocking the second socket, making it ideal for expanding smart routines. Compared to more advanced smart home hubs, this plug is simple to set up and works exclusively with Alexa, which could be a limitation if you prefer multi-assistant compatibility. It’s perfect for dads who want to control lamps, fans, or appliances remotely or on a schedule without fuss. However, its lack of 5GHz Wi-Fi support and indoor-only design mean it’s less suited for complex or outdoor setups.

    The Echo Show 5 offers a compact 5.5-inch display that excels in multimedia, video calls, and smart home control. Its enhanced audio with deeper bass makes listening more enjoyable, and the built-in camera adds security or the ability to make video calls. Compared to the Echo Spot, the larger screen makes it better for watching news or quick video chats, but it’s still small enough for bedside tables or kitchens. Privacy is well thought out, with hardware mic and camera controls, and sustainability features appeal to eco-conscious buyers. This device suits dads who want a versatile hub that combines entertainment, security, and smart home management in a space-saving package.

Connectivity and Ecosystem Compatibility

When choosing, consider whether dad prefers Alexa or other voice assistants. Most of these devices integrate seamlessly with Alexa, but if he’s invested in Google or Apple ecosystems, some options may be less compatible. Also, assess Wi-Fi support—dual-band connectivity and extender features improve performance, especially in larger homes.

Do these gadgets require a hub or additional equipment?

The Amazon Smart Plug and Echo Show 5 do not require a hub, simplifying installation. The Echo Spot, with built-in Wi-Fi and eero support, also doesn’t need extra hubs, but optimal network coverage might depend on existing Wi-Fi setup. Devices that rely solely on Wi-Fi tend to be easier to set up and expand.

Are these devices privacy-focused?

All three devices include privacy controls. The Echo Spot and Echo Show 5 have physical mic and camera off buttons, and the Echo Show 5 offers a camera shutter for added security. The Smart Plug does not have privacy controls but doesn’t pose privacy concerns beyond typical IoT device considerations. Always review manufacturer privacy settings to ensure comfort.
